Self-diagnosis display
— If a code starting with an alphabet letter appears

Your camera has a self-diagnosis display.
This function displays the camera condition
on the LCD screen with a combination of a
letter and four numerical digits.
If this occurs, check the following code
chart and attempt the corresponding
corrective actions. The last two digits
(indicated by ss) will differ depending on
the state of the camera.

Self-diagnosis display

If you are unable to solve the problem even
after trying the corrective actions a few
times, repairs may be necessary. Contact
your Sony dealer or local authorized Sony
service facility and inform them of the 5-
digit code.
Example: E:61:10

Code

Cause

Countermeasure

C:32:

ss

There is trouble with your
camera’s hardware.

• Turn the power off and on again (page 14).

C:13:

ss

The camera cannot read or write
data on the “Memory Stick.”

• Re-insert the “Memory Stick” several times.

An unformatted “Memory Stick”
is inserted.

• Format the “Memory Stick” (page 45).

The inserted “Memory Stick”
cannot be used with your camera,
or the data is damaged.

• Insert a new “Memory Stick” (page 17).

E:61:

ss

E:91:

ss

A camera malfunction that you
cannot reverse has occurred.

• Press the RESET button (page 59) located on the

bottom of the camera, then turn the power on
again.
